What are the disadvantages of trading with Kyogin Securities?

While Kyogin Securities is regulated and offers a variety of investment products, the primary disadvantage is its trading fees. The fees can be relatively high, especially for smaller trades. For example, for trades up to ¥1,000,000, the commission is 1.21%, which may not be cost-effective for smaller traders. Additionally, the minimum commission charge of ¥2,750 could be a deterrent for those with smaller portfolios. From my experience, these fees could be an issue for retail traders who trade in smaller volumes.
